Project Description
In 2005 the humanitarian community undertook an independent review to assess the humanitarian response capacities of United Nations agencies the Red Cross/Red Crescent Movement non-governmental organizations and other humanitarian actors. One of the challenges identified by the review was the low-level of preparedness for rapid response specifically in terms of qualified and easily deployable humanitarian experts. To enhance the timeliness reliability and effectiveness of international responses to humanitarian crises CIDA through CANADEM is developing and maintaining a roster of highly qualified Canadian disaster relief and humanitarian experts to be rapidly deployed to international humanitarian agencies responding to rapid-onset crises. The purpose of the CANADEM project is to deploy Canadian experts to natural disasters or conflict zones in the immediate aftermath of a crisis.
